Crystal Structure of a Soluble Rieske Ferredoxin from Mus musculus
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 6 | 293 | Protein Solution (~15 mg/ml native protein, 0.025 M NaCl, 0.005 M MOPS pH 7.0) mixed in a 1:1 ratio with Well Solution ( 25% MEPEG 5K, 0.12 M Trisodium citrate, 0.10 M MES ph 6.0) Cryoprotected with 15% ethylene glycol; Mercury derivative crystal soaked overnight in in mother liquor containing 0.002 M thimersol, vapor diffusion, hanging drop, temperature 293K, VAPOR DIFFUSION, HANGING DROP |
